"Civil Procedure Law": Article 225 If a party or interested party thinks that the execution is in violation of the law, he may file a written objection to the people's court in charge of execution. If a party or interested party raises a written objection, the people's court shall conduct an examination within 15 days from the date of receiving the written objection. If the reason is established, it shall make a ruling to cancel or correct it; If the reason cannot be established, the ruling shall be rejected. If a party or interested party refuses to accept the award, it may apply to the people's court at the next higher level for reconsideration within ten days from the date of service of the award. Article 227 In the course of execution, if an outsider raises a written objection to the execution target, the people's court shall conduct an examination within 15 days from the date of receiving the written objection, and if the reason is established, it shall order to suspend the execution target; If the reason cannot be established, the ruling shall be rejected. If an outsider or a party refuses to accept the ruling and thinks that the original judgment or ruling is wrong, it shall be handled in accordance with the procedure of trial supervision; If it has nothing to do with the original judgment or ruling, it may bring a lawsuit to the people's court within 15 days from the date when the ruling is served. The Supreme People's Court's explanation on the application of the Civil Procedure Law of People's Republic of China (PRC): Article 464 According to the provisions of Article 227 of the Civil Procedure Law, if an outsider raises an objection to the object of execution, it shall do so before the end of the execution procedure of the object of execution. Article 465 If an outsider raises an objection to the subject matter of execution, it shall be dealt with according to the following circumstances after examination: (1) If the outsider does not enjoy the rights and interests sufficient to exclude execution, an order shall be made to reject his objection; (2) If the outsider enjoys enough rights and interests to exclude the execution of the subject matter, the execution shall be suspended. The people's court shall not punish the object of execution within 15 days from the date when the ruling rejecting the execution objection of the outsider is served on the outsider. Provisions of the Supreme People's Court on Several Issues Concerning the People's Court Handling Cases of Reconsideration of Objection to Execution: Article 2 If the objection to execution meets the conditions stipulated in Article 225 or Article 227 of the Civil Procedure Law, the people's court shall file a case within three days, and notify the objector and relevant parties within three days after filing the case. Do not meet the conditions for acceptance, the ruling will not be accepted; If it is found that it does not meet the acceptance conditions after filing the case, the application shall be rejected. If the application for execution of objection materials is incomplete, the people's court shall inform the objector to make corrections within three days at one time, and if it fails to make corrections within the time limit, it will not be accepted. If the objector refuses to accept the ruling of not accepting or rejecting the application, he may apply to the people's court at the next higher level for reconsideration within 10 days from the date of service of the ruling. If the people's court at the next higher level considers that it meets the acceptance conditions after examination, it shall make a ruling to revoke the original ruling, instruct the enforcement court to file a case or review the enforcement objection. Article 3 If the enforcement court fails to file a case within three days after receiving the execution objection and makes a ruling of inadmissibility, or fails to make a ruling of objection within the statutory time limit without justifiable reasons after accepting it, the objector may raise an objection to the people's court at the next higher level. If the people's court at the next higher level considers that the reasons are valid after examination, it shall order the enforcement court to file a case within three days or make an objection ruling within fifteen days.
